Law & Order: SVU Season 26 Episode 5: Economics of Shame - A Harrowing Tale of Sextortion and Survival

In the gripping fifth episode of Law & Order: Special Victims Unit's 26th season, titled "Economics of Shame," the show delves into the chilling reality of sextortion, a crime that has become increasingly prevalent in the digital age. The episode follows the harrowing journey of Kelsey Sommers, a TV reporter, as she becomes the victim of a devious extortion plot that threatens to destroy her career and personal life.

The episode begins with Kelsey, who has been hesitant to date since her engagement ended disastrously, taking the plunge into the world of online dating. She matches with a man named Tyler, who seems charming and attractive. Their first date goes exceptionally well, leading to an intimate night together. In the aftermath of their encounter, Kelsey, feeling a connection, sends Tyler risqué photos of herself, believing they share a private and trusting relationship.

However, Kelsey's trust is tragically misplaced. Tyler's true colors emerge when he uses the intimate photos to extort money from her, threatening to send the images to everyone in her contact list if she doesn't comply. This shocking turn of events pushes Kelsey to the brink of despair, leading her to consider taking her own life as a means of escape from the humiliation and the potential ruin of her reputation.

In a desperate act, Kelsey's mother calls 911, and Captain Benson from the SVU arrives on the scene. Recognizing the severity of the situation, Benson reassures Kelsey that she does not have to face this ordeal alone. With the support of the SVU team, Kelsey agrees to pursue justice against her extortionist.

As the investigation unfolds, Kelsey is admitted to a psychiatric hospital on a suicide hold, a measure intended to protect her from herself. However, in a rare move, the hospital allows Kelsey to be interviewed by the SVU team. It is during this interview that the full extent of Tyler's betrayal comes to light. Not only did he take compromising photos, but he also secretly recorded a video of their intimate encounter, ensuring he has leverage over Kelsey.

The video, captured without Kelsey's knowledge or consent, is a devastating blow. Tyler escalates his demands, and Kelsey, feeling cornered, checks herself out of the hospital early to confront the situation head-on. She reveals to the SVU team that her life has been a series of unfortunate events, with her ex-fiancé leaving her with nothing but her career—a career that is now hanging by a thread due to the potential release of the sex tape.

The episode does not shy away from exploring the emotional turmoil Kelsey faces. Her past, marked by a failed engagement and financial ruin, contrasts sharply with her present, where she is fighting for her professional and personal dignity. The SVU team, led by the tenacious Captain Benson, works tirelessly to track down Tyler and bring him to justice.
